People People

Who They Are. Why They Win. How To Be One.

If you’ve ever heard of someone described as “a real people person” and agreed, you no doubt immediately thought “Boy, we could use more people like that!” And you’d be right. There are truths that are universally acknowledged: a people person will smoothly, successfully engage in effective, pleasant human interactions. They are more likely to be promoted, respected, admired, complimented and appreciated than those who simply do not know how to thrive among humans. Simply put, everyone could benefit from being a people person, but many just don’t know how or don’t know where to find the answers.

Supported by interviews, case studies and sound research, People People will teach why being a people person even matters, what makes a people person, and how and where to be a people person.

Scott Christopher is a nationally recognized author, speaker and corporate trainer. As co-author of the bestseller The Levity Effect: Why It Pays to Lighten Up, he has appeared on NBC’s Today Show, CNBC, Fox News and in the New York Times, Washington Post, Newsweek, Wall Street Journal, Boston Globe, The Economist, ESPN the Magazine, Ladies Home Journal and many others. He lives in Salt Lake City, Utah.
